July: An Unusual Talent

The Covid shutdown of 2020 was pure opportunity for Ben Jurgensen, then a 33 year-old sculpture studio teacher at the Rhode Island School of Design. Freed from the routine of everyday life, he started on the path of bicycle frame building to create July Bicycles. He describes that time as “my sourdough."

The Everything Bike - And Then Some

An astonishingly efficient all-rounder, this bike by Naked does everything well. Its primary purpose is 75-100 mile mixed-surface rides with 10,000ft climbing and descending. Good riders on other bikes have been unable to even finish these rides. In my view, energy saved by this bike is what made the difference.

Fine Bikes are in The House!

Stepping up from bike maintenance to frame building is, well it's more a leap of faith. Charles Thompson of Fine Bikes completed that leap last year, and in the biking boom town of Raleigh, North Carolina, he's plying a healthy trade in partnership with Oak City Cycles.
